Best Motion Picture of the Year

12 Years A Slave 

Brad Pitt, Dede Gardner, Jeremy Kleiner, Steve McQueen, and Anthony Katagas, Producers

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role

Matthew McConaugheyDallas Buyers Club

Performance by an Actor in a Supporting Role

Jared LetoDallas Buyers Club

Performance by an Actress in a Leading Role

Cate BlanchettBlue Jasmine

Performance by an Actress in a Supporting Role

Lupita Nyong’o12 Years A Slave

Best Animated Feature Film of the Year

Chris Buck, Jennifer Lee, and Peter Del VechoFrozen 

Achievement in Cinematography

Emmanuel LubezkiGravity 

Achievement in Costume Design

Catherine MartinThe Great Gatsby 

Achievement in Directing

Alfonso CuarónGravity 

Best Documentary Feature

Morgan Neville, Gil Friesen, and Caitrin Rogers20 Feet From Stardom 

Best Documentary Short Subject

Malcolm Clarke and Nicholas Reed, The Lady In Number 6: Music Saved My Life 

Achievement in Film Editing

Alfonso Cuarón and Mark Sanger​Gravity 

Best Foreign Language Film of the Year

The Great Beauty—Italy 

Achievement in Makeup and Hairstyling

Adruitha Lee and Robin MathewsDallas Buyers Club 

Achievement in Music Written for Motion Pictures (Original Score)

Steven PriceGravity 

Achievement in Music Written for Motion Pictures (Original Song)

"Let It Go," Frozen 

Music and Lyric by Kristen Anderson-Lopez and Robert Lopez

Achievement in Production Design

The Great Gatsby 

Production Design: Catherine Martin; Set Decoration: Beverley Dunn

Best Animated Short Film 

Laurent Witz and Alexandre Espigares, Mr. Hublot 

Best Live Action Short Film

Anders Walter and Kim Magnusson, Helium 

Achievement in Sound Editing

Glenn Freemantle​, Gravity 

Achievement in Sound Mixing

Skip Lievsay, Niv Adiri, Christopher Benstead, and Chris MunroGravity 

Achievement in Visual Effects

Tim Webber, Chris Lawrence, Dave Shirk, and Neil CorbouldGravity 

Adapted Screenplay

John Ridley12 Years A Slave 

Original Screenplay

Spike JonzeHer
